A cot-bed is a bigger, lower-sided bed.

A cot-bed is a large and flexible option for your child's bed. It can be used as a baby crib and then transformed into a toddler bed so that it grows with your child. This allows you to save money on a new bed once your child is ready to move to a single bed. It is also more secure for your child than a traditional cot with a drop side. Be aware that some cots come with drop sides that aren't safe for babies. This is because infants may be trapped in the gap, or suffocate when they fall over. If your crib has a drop side, be sure it has a two-handed dropping mechanism so that only adults can use it.
